Relaxation and quiet time
Created: Thursday, November 15, 2001
You have to take time out every single day to sit back, breathe deeply, relax and enjoy life in the present moment. It is important to create a gap between work and home environment. Always have mental and physical activities in your life that you enjoy. Make these pastimes separate from your work life. It reminds us to keep work in an important but appropriate place.

A bath with soothing aromatic essential oils (e.g. camomile, lavender, neroli, sandalwood); soft candlelight and gentle music will do wonders for any disturbed soul.

The following are suggestions: join a practical philosophy class, do progressive muscle relaxation exercises, meditation, yoga, pottery or painting, classical or relaxation music (nature sounds, soft, instrumental), gym, aerobic class, candlelight dinner, start a walking, wine tasting, or book club.

Remember all religions have a rich and strong history of meditation which we seem to have lost along the way as the world became materialistic and analytical. Prayer is also good for obtaining balance. Prayer is actually where you communicate with God. Meditation is where you become silent, reach your own inner strength and power and allow God to communicate with you. You don’t have to go to formal religious meetings to enrich your soul. You can practice on your own, with a group, or with your family.

Imagine your thoughts being the waves on the surface of the ocean. They go up and down as the mood, your feelings, emotions and your memory dictate. The deeper ocean is quiet, still and peaceful. This is the part you can access voluntarily any time of the day and night through meditation, visualisation, deep breathing and prayer.

I strongly recommend Dr. Herbert Benson's Relaxation Response.

Creative visualisation is also very effective as a relaxation tool. Once you've relaxed as described, visualise (see in your mind's eye) yourself in a peaceful garden. Use all your senses to experience your imaginary surroundings. Look at what you can see, taste the air, smell the grass, flowers, listen to the birds, the wind blowing through the leaves, feel the air against your skin, taste the freshness. You will often find solutions to niggling problems once you give your mind a chance to turn back into itself instead of constantly being busy with monkey chatter.

Listen to your body:

Stress-related illness would include frequent colds, depression, eczema, premenstrual tension, frequent other irritating infections, asthma, irritable bowel syndrome, peptic ulcers, gastritis, arthritis, allergies, diabetes, hypertension, high cholesterol, etc. Nearly all our modern day diseases have an underlying stress component. If you get frequent colds or fever blisters (cold sores), it’s time to sit up, take notice and take a break! Your immune system is showing you that you’re overdoing it.
